import mir.entity.EntityList;
import mir.log.LoggerWrapper;
import mir.storage.Database;
-import mir.storage.StorageObjectFailure;
+import mir.storage.DatabaseFailure;
import mircoders.entity.EntityUploadedMedia;
/**
* <b>implements abstract DB connection to the content_x_media SQL table
*
* @author RK, mir-coders group
- * @version $Id: DatabaseContentToMedia.java,v 1.19.2.9 2005/02/10 16:22:22 rhindes Exp $
+ * @version $Id: DatabaseContentToMedia.java,v 1.19.2.10 2005/03/26 11:26:28 zapata Exp $
*
*/
}
public void addMedia(String contentId, String mediaId) throws
- StorageObjectFailure {
+ DatabaseFailure {
if (contentId == null && mediaId == null) {
return;
}
}
catch (Exception e) {
logger.error("-- add media failed -- insert");
- throw new StorageObjectFailure("-- add media failed -- insert ", e);
+ throw new DatabaseFailure("-- add media failed -- insert ", e);
}
finally {
freeConnection(con, stmt);
}
public void setMedia(String contentId, String mediaId) throws
- StorageObjectFailure {
+ DatabaseFailure {
if (contentId == null && mediaId == null) {
return;
}
}
catch (Exception e) {
logger.error("-- set media failed -- delete");
- throw new StorageObjectFailure("-- set media failed -- delete ", e);
+ throw new DatabaseFailure("-- set media failed -- delete ", e);
}
finally {
freeConnection(con, stmt);
}
catch (Exception e) {
logger.error("-- set media failed -- insert");
- throw new StorageObjectFailure("-- set media failed -- insert ", e);
+ throw new DatabaseFailure("-- set media failed -- insert ", e);
}
finally {
freeConnection(con, stmt);
}
}
- public void deleteByContentId(String contentId) throws StorageObjectFailure {
+ public void deleteByContentId(String contentId) throws DatabaseFailure {
if (contentId == null) {
//theLog.printDebugInfo("-- delete topics failed -- no content id");
return;
}
catch (Exception e) {
logger.error("-- delete by contentId failed ");
- throw new StorageObjectFailure(
+ throw new DatabaseFailure(
"-- delete by content id failed -- delete ", e);
}
finally {
}
}
- public void deleteByMediaId(String mediaId) throws StorageObjectFailure {
+ public void deleteByMediaId(String mediaId) throws DatabaseFailure {
if (mediaId == null) {
//theLog.printDebugInfo("-- delete topics failed -- no topic id");
}
catch (Exception e) {
logger.error("-- delete media failed ");
- throw new StorageObjectFailure("-- delete by media id failed -- ", e);
+ throw new DatabaseFailure("-- delete by media id failed -- ", e);
}
finally {
freeConnection(con, stmt);
}
public void delete(String contentId, String mediaId) throws
- StorageObjectFailure {
+ DatabaseFailure {
if (mediaId == null || contentId == null) {
logger.debug("-- delete media failed -- missing parameter");
return;
}
catch (Exception e) {
logger.error("-- delete content_x_media failed ");
- throw new StorageObjectFailure("-- delete content_x_media failed -- ", e);
+ throw new DatabaseFailure("-- delete content_x_media failed -- ", e);
}
finally {
freeConnection(con, stmt);
}
public EntityList getContent(EntityUploadedMedia media) throws
- StorageObjectFailure {
+ DatabaseFailure {
EntityList returnList = null;
if (media != null) {
}
catch (Exception e) {
logger.error("-- get content failed");
- throw new StorageObjectFailure("-- get content failed -- ", e);
+ throw new DatabaseFailure("-- get content failed -- ", e);
}
}
return returnList;
* Returns a EntityList with all content-objects having a relation to a media
*/
- public EntityList getContent() throws StorageObjectFailure {
+ public EntityList getContent() throws DatabaseFailure {
EntityList returnList = null;
}
catch (Exception e) {
logger.error("-- get content failed");
- throw new StorageObjectFailure("-- get content failed -- ", e);
+ throw new DatabaseFailure("-- get content failed -- ", e);
}
return returnList;
}